Greasing Bearings on the Boreas XT (2020 and older models)

Keep the wheels turning smoothly on your camper trailer by regularly greasing the bearings

One of the ways to ensure the integrity and longevity of your Boreas Campers camper trailer is to grease the bearings. This can be done at any RV service shop, or schedule a service appointment by emailing service@boreascampers.com. Follow the steps below to grease the bearrings of your Timbren suspension. 

Blaster Maximum HD Grease is used by Boreas Campers for the bearings, bushings and hitch zerk.

First – place a flathead screwdriver under the rubber end cap, and pull it completely off.

Secondly – Fit a grease pump (standard vehicle grease will do the trick) onto the zerk.

Start with 6 pumps of grease and inspect with a light to see if grease is coming out of the sides of the bearing. If no movement is detected add another 6 pumps, which will be enough to lubricate the area if it is completely empty. 

Replace the cover and you’re good to go for the next adventure in your camper trailer!
